Key Insights
Applied Digital signed a 15-year lease for 210 MW at Delta Forge 2 with a U.S.-based hyperscaler, valued at approximately $5.2 billion in base-term contracted revenue.
The company's total contracted portfolio now spans five AI Factory campuses, representing 1.4 GW of critical IT load and approximately $36 billion in base-term lease revenue.
Approximately 70% of Applied Digital's contracted revenue is now backed by U.S.-based investment-grade hyperscalers, enhancing revenue stability.
